Child getting struck by lawn mower in Yates County
Yates County, New York — A child is being struck and injured by a lawn mower.
According to a first responders report, on October 29, a child suffered severe injuries after their mother accidentally hit them with a lawn mower at Keuka Park.
The child had to be transported to Strong Memorial Hospital by helicopter, because of the injuries to the legs and arms.
A 28-year-old, Rhonda Zimmerman was operating the lawn mower when she accidentally backed over her 15-month-old child.
